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Charing (Kent) to Dronfield start from as little as £23.00

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Charing (Kent) to Dronfield start from £74.10 one way, or £128.50 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Charing (Kent) to Dronfield are available for £156.60 one way, or £307.30 return

Station Facilities and Services

At Charing Station, simplicity is key while attending to essential needs. Ticket purchasing is made straightforward, with a ticket office open from 07:15 to 11:40 on weekdays, supplemented by accessible ticket machines for those quick buys on the go. Smartcards are issued here, though don't expect the convenience of validators, adding a note of traditionalism to your journey.

For those needing a little extra assistance, the station provides help points, CCTV for added security, and staff presence during morning hours on weekdays. Step-free access is available primarily for services away from London, but travelers should take heed of the footbridge which offers access to other platforms without step-free options. Unfortunately, amenities like refreshment facilities, shops, and an ATM are absent, so arrive prepared.

Facilities and Services at Dronfield Station

Dronfield station comes equipped with basic yet essential facilities. Although there isn’t a staffed ticket office available, travelers can make use of the self-service ticket machines on-site to purchase and collect tickets. For tech-savvy passengers, the station does support smartcards, so you can easily manage your travels digitally.

Accessibility is a key consideration at Dronfield with step-free access parts, making it relatively easy for wheelchair users and passengers with limited mobility to navigate the station. However, it's worth noting that there are no accessible ticket machines, and assistance might be limited due to the unstaffed nature of the station. If assistance is required, travelers can contact the helpline at 08002006060 or use customer help points available at the station.

Other Amenities and Parking

While Dronfield may not have a wide array of amenities such as shops or refreshment facilities, it does provide some practical conveniences. Payphones and bicycle storage options are available, with sheltered stands for up to eight bicycles right outside the station. However, there are no dedicated spaces for accessible vehicles in the car park, which is operated by the local council and open 24 hours.

If you need to park your vehicle, there are fifty spaces available, though CCTV is not present in the car park. Parking is quite reasonable with charges like £1 for up to two hours, ensuring that your journey remains cost-effective from start to finish.
